Posted April 27, 2008  Front Range Village is planning to open around July 28, 2008. Just three short months and Fort Collins Shoppers will have many new stores in which to keep our economy rolling. Area shoppers as far away as Nebraska and Wyoming are also looking forward to the opening of this brand new life style center.

In conjunction with the Promenade Shops and Marketplace in Loveland it will give regional shoppers one of the best shopping areas in the state of Colorado in which to shop.

As of this date the anchors are Lowes, Super target, Staples, Sports Authority and Toy's R Us/Baby's R Us. Also committed are Lane Bryant, Dress barn, DSW, Payless and Famous Footwear. Specialty stores are Ulta Cosmetics, Great Clips, Game Shop, Foothills Cleaners, Runners Roost, GNC, Compass Bank and Claires. All of the specialty shops except Ulta presently have Fort Collins locations and no announcements yet whether these are additional locations or whether they will be moving to this new location.

Only three food locations have officially announced but the leasing people have stated that there are negations going on with restaurants of all calibers some brand new to Fort Collins. The three committed restaurants are Qdoba, Silver Mine Subs and Juice It Up.

The city of Fort Collins is still very concerned about sales tax drain to Loveland and Timnath or so they are saying. However, at the same time they turn down the re-zoning of and area for retail and office commercial at Prospect and I-25. This decision will insure that the drain will continue as Timnath will get the retail planned for that interstate intersection.

Posted October 27, 2006  Front Range Village Planning. From this 109 acre former corn field will develop Fort Collins newest shopping extravaganza. This will be the home of Front Range Village. Front Range Village is being developed by Bayer Properties a national developer of well designed and well thought out commercial developments.

The 109 acres will be built into a 900,000 square foot commercial retail and office development. This town center concept will be slightly larger than it's already developed neighbor to the south The Promenade Shops at Centerra.


At the present time ground breaking is scheduled for early 2007. The two major tenants which have been announced are a Super Target and a Lowe's Home Improvement Center.

Since Bayer's design beginnings of this project their has been talk and planning for a new branch library built into this project. At this stage the plan is still there. However, the city has budget problems so the library idea has remained an idea.  There is an upcoming election with a special referendum included on the ballot for additional library funding. If this passes it is quite possible that it will provide for a much needed library expansion at this location.

Front Range Village will be a hybrid mix of large format retail, junior anchors and many restaurant parcel on the perimeters. One of the unique design features is that the Village will include office space on the second floors of some buildings. That feature along with the diagonal parking feature will give the village a feeling much like old downtown Fort Collins. The village will incorporate many small retail stores along it's streetscape and offer shoppers and visitors many sidewalks to stroll about on.

The center will have excellent pedestrian and bicycle access via many pathways. As you can see in the plans below their are many water features that will be incorporated in the design.
